Nicotine Pouches vs. Gum: The Ultimate Guide to Quitting Smoking

Are you looking for a way to quit smoking? If so, you're not alone. Millions of people around the world are trying to kick the habit, and many are turning to nicotine pouches and gum as a way to help them quit.

But what's the difference between nicotine pouches and gum? And which one is right for you? In this article, we'll take a closer look at both options and help you make the best decision for your needs.

Benefits of Nicotine Pouches vs. Gum

Both nicotine pouches and gum can help you quit smoking by providing you with a way to get your nicotine fix without actually smoking. This can help to reduce your cravings and make it easier to quit.

nicotine pouches vs gum

However, there are some key benefits of nicotine pouches over gum.

  • Nicotine pouches are discreet and easy to use. You can use them anywhere, even in places where smoking is not allowed.
  • Nicotine pouches do not contain tobacco, so they do not produce any harmful smoke or tar.
  • Nicotine pouches come in a variety of flavors, so you can find one that you enjoy.

How to Use Nicotine Pouches vs. Gum

Nicotine pouches and gum are both easy to use.

  • To use nicotine pouches, simply place the pouch between your upper lip and gum and leave it there for about 30 minutes. The nicotine will be absorbed through the lining of your mouth.
  • To use nicotine gum, chew the gum until it becomes soft and then place it between your cheek and gum. Chew the gum for about 30 minutes and then remove it.

6-8 Effective Strategies, Tips and Tricks, Common Mistakes to Avoid

  • Set a quit date. This will give you something to work towards and help you stay motivated.
  • Tell your friends and family that you're quitting. They can provide support and encouragement.
  • Find a support group. This can provide you with a community of people who are going through the same thing.
  • Avoid triggers. These are things that make you want to smoke, such as stress, alcohol, or certain social situations.
  • Be patient. It takes time to quit smoking. Don't get discouraged if you slip up. Just pick yourself up and keep trying.

What to Be Careful About

Nicotine pouches and gum are both safe and effective ways to quit smoking. However, there are a few things to keep in mind.

  • Nicotine is addictive. If you use nicotine pouches or gum for too long, you may become addicted to nicotine.
  • Nicotine can cause side effects. These side effects can include nausea, vomiting, diarrhea, and headaches.
  • Nicotine can interact with other medications. If you take any medications, be sure to talk to your doctor before using nicotine pouches or gum.
